I am from Matamoros, a small town in the state of Tamaulipas in Mexico. I have been in swimming there since I was 4 years old. Since then I dedicate my life to it. I began to compete on state level at my 10 years old and qualify 5 times for National championships Class B in Mexico from 13 to 15 years old. When COVID hit and swimming in Mexico stopped completely, I moved to the US looking for better life and better opportunities in sports. Even though was hard adapting to a new school and sports system, perseverance and persistence made me who I become know. My first year of school I was unable to be in the varsity team because of my school zone. This became a challenge to confront a whole year, but when my senior season started, times dropped until I got my qualification to state just on my first season. Two years from now, reaching my goals and making my parents proud of who I am now made me a better student-athlete.
